On Oct 14, 3:14 pm, Aaron Newton <[email protected]> wrote:
> Binds is probably going to be deprecated at some point in the relatively
> near future in favor of a different solution to this problem. Instead you
> should probably just do something like:
>
> this._bound = {
>   foo: this.foo.bind(this)
>
> };
>
> this.addEvent('foo', this._bound.foo);
>
> It's clunky, and it's what Binds was meant to fix, but ultimately Binds has
> other issues, like the one you describe...
